electron : Idioms & Phrases
- electron accelerator
- electron beam
- electron gun
- electron lens
- electron microscope
- electron microscopic
- electron microscopy
- electron multiplier
- electron optics
- electron orbit
- electron paramagnetic resonance
- electron radiation
- electron shell
- electron spin resonance
- electron tube
- electron volt
- free electron
- valence electron
electron accelerator
noun collider that consists of an accelerator that collides electrons and positrons
electron beam
noun a group of nearly parallel lines of electromagnetic radiation
beam; ray.
electron gun
noun the electrode that is the source of electrons in a cathode-ray tube or electron microscope; consists of a cathode that emits a stream of electrons and the electrostatic or electromagnetic apparatus that focuses it
electron lens
noun electronic equipment that uses a magnetic or electric field in order to focus a beam of electrons
electron microscope
noun a microscope that is similar in purpose to a light microscope but achieves much greater resolving power by using a parallel beam of electrons to illuminate the object instead of a beam of light
electron microscopic
adjective of or relating to or involving an electron microscope
electron microscopy
noun microscopy with the use of electron microscopes
electron multiplier
noun a vacuum tube that amplifies a flow of electrons
electron optics
noun the branch of electronics that deals with beams of electrons and their focusing and deflection by magnetic fields
electron orbit
noun the path of an electron around the nucleus of an atom
electron paramagnetic resonance
noun microwave spectroscopy in which there is resonant absorption of radiation by a paramagnet
electron paramagnetic resonance; ESR.
electron radiation
noun radiation of beta particles during radioactive decay
beta radiation; beta ray.
electron shell
noun a grouping of electrons surrounding the nucleus of an atom
- the chemical properties of an atom are determined by the outermost electron shell
electron spin resonance
noun microwave spectroscopy in which there is resonant absorption of radiation by a paramagnet
electron paramagnetic resonance; ESR.
electron tube
noun electronic device consisting of a system of electrodes arranged in an evacuated glass or metal envelope
vacuum tube; tube; thermionic vacuum tube; thermionic valve; thermionic tube.
electron volt
noun a unit of energy equal to the work done by an electron accelerated through a potential difference of 1 volt
free electron
noun electron that is not attached to an atom or ion or molecule but is free to move under the influence of an electric field
valence electron
noun an electron in the outer shell of an atom which can combine with other atoms to form molecules